1993 Ford Versailles vs. 1980 Ford Laser
To start off, 1993 Ford Versailles is newer by 13 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1980 Ford Laser.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1980 Ford Laser would be higher. At 1,779 cc (4 cylinders), 1993 Ford Versailles is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1980 Ford Laser (94 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 1993 Ford Versailles. (91 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1980 Ford Laser should accelerate faster than 1993 Ford Versailles.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1993 Ford Versailles (144 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 21 more torque (in Nm) than 1980 Ford Laser. (123 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1993 Ford Versailles will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1980 Ford Laser.
Compare all specifications:
1993 Ford Versailles | 1980 Ford Laser | |
Make | Ford | Ford |
Model | Versailles | Laser |
Year Released | 1993 | 1980 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1779 cc | 1490 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 91 HP | 94 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 144 Nm | 123 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 4570 mm | 3960 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1710 mm | 1640 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1380 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2560 mm | 2370 mm |
